  1. Today,  Woodlands Elementary ROX is hosting a District wide Purple Out and Jeans Day. Please join us in dressing in purple attire to honor the life of Evelyn Bauer, a student of Huron City Schools who passed away suddenly last year. Monetary donations are welcome and appreciated, and will be collected today in your first period class or the main office. The donations will be given to the Bauer family for the nonprofit organization that they created in Evelyn's honor, All for Evelyn.
